The Anatomy of a Hinge: What Makes Them Different (and Sometimes Not Interchangeable)

Okay, let’s break down what’s actually going on with these hinges. When you look at a lid hinge, it’s not just a simple metal joint.

There are several factors that dictate whether one hinge can be swapped for another, and most of the time, the answer to ‘are lid hinges interchangeable?’ leans towards ‘no, not easily.’ The first thing to consider is the material. A hinge on a cheap plastic cooler will likely be made of plastic itself or thin, stamped aluminum.

A hinge on a heavy-duty stainless steel grill? That’s going to be solid steel, probably powder-coated or plated to resist rust. Putting a flimsy plastic hinge on a heavy lid would be a disaster waiting to happen. It would bend, warp, and eventually snap under the weight.

Conversely, a heavy steel hinge might be too much for a light plastic application, potentially cracking the plastic mounting points.

Then there’s the mounting style and pattern. This is where most DIYers trip up. Hinges attach via screws, bolts, or sometimes rivets.

The distance between these attachment points, the size of the holes, and the overall shape of the mounting plate are all important. Even if the hinge looks like it will fit, if the screw holes are off by even a quarter-inch, you’re either drilling new holes (which can weaken the material) or you’re forcing it, which leads to stress and eventual failure. Dimensions are also huge. This includes the overall length of the hinge, the width of the barrels (the part where the pin goes), the width of the leaves (the flat parts that attach to the lid and the base), and the length of the pin itself. These measurements affect how the lid opens, how far it opens, and how it sits when closed. A hinge that’s too long or too short can cause the lid to bind or not close flush.

A hinge with a different barrel width might mean the pin is too short or too long, affecting stability. Finally, consider the pivot point and opening angle. Some hinges are designed to allow a lid to open 90 degrees, others 180 degrees, and some even more.

If you put a 90-degree hinge on something designed for 180, you’ll limit its functionality. These aren’t just cosmetic differences; they are engineered features. So, when you’re asking if are lid hinges interchangeable, remember that these subtle differences add up to a big ‘no’ for most generic replacements.

What to Look for: The Practical Checklist for Hinge Replacement

So, you’ve decided you need to replace a hinge, and you’re past the point of just grabbing the first thing that looks similar. Good. Now, what do you actually need to check? Let’s create a practical checklist. First, and this is a must: Identify the Original Manufacturer and Model. If possible, find the brand name and model number of the item the hinge belongs to. This is your golden ticket. A quick search on the manufacturer’s website or a call to their customer service department can often get you the exact replacement part. This is the surest way to guarantee interchangeability.

If you absolutely cannot find an OEM part, then you need to get out your measuring tape and a notepad. Measure everything. Measure the total length and width of the hinge when it’s closed and when it’s open. Measure the length and width of each leaf (the part that attaches to the lid and the base). Measure the diameter and length of the pin. Pay close attention to the screw hole pattern. Measure the distance from the center of one hole to the center of the next, both horizontally and vertically. Note the diameter of the screw holes themselves. This is often overlooked, but important for screw compatibility.

Next, consider the material and finish. Is the original hinge made of steel, aluminum, brass, or plastic? What kind of finish does it have (e.g., powder-coated, zinc-plated, stainless steel)? You want a replacement that matches in terms of durability and corrosion resistance. A steel hinge on a marine application without proper plating will rust away in no time. Also, look at the type of hinge. Is it a butt hinge, a continuous hinge, a strap hinge, or something else? Does it have a specific opening angle? Some hinges are designed to stop at a certain point, which is important for preventing damage or making sure proper function.

Finally, consider the attachment method. Are the original hinges screwed, riveted, or bolted on? If they’re riveted, you’ll need to drill them out and will likely need to replace them with screws or bolts. The strength of the material you’re attaching to matters here. A heavy-duty hinge might require thicker material than what your item provides. Here’s a quick comparison table to help visualize:

Feature Criticality for Interchangeability Why it Matters My Verdict
Manufacturer/Model Highest Makes sure exact fit and material specs. Always try for OEM first.
Screw Hole Pattern & Size High Incorrect pattern means drilling new holes or a poor fit. Measure precisely; slight variations can cause major issues.
Overall Dimensions (Length, Width) High Affects lid closure, alignment, and clearance. Even 1/4 inch difference can be a problem.
Material & Finish Medium-High Durability, corrosion resistance, and weight capacity. Don’t swap metal for plastic or vice-versa without serious thought.
Pin Diameter & Length Medium Affects stability and how smoothly the lid pivots. Can sometimes be shimmed, but better if it matches.
Opening Angle/Stop Medium Determines how far the lid opens; prevents damage. Important for usability, especially on enclosed items.

Remember, the goal is not just to get a lid attached, but to have it function as intended, safely and durably. If you’re in doubt, it’s often better to wait and find the right part than to install something that will fail prematurely.

Can I Use Any Hinge for My Toolbox?

Generally, no. While toolboxes might seem straightforward, hinge designs vary significantly. You need to match the mounting pattern, size, and material. A cheap plastic toolbox might use lightweight plastic hinges, while a heavy-duty metal one requires solid steel hinges. Always check the original manufacturer’s specifications or carefully measure your existing hinges before attempting a replacement.

What If I Can’t Find the Original Hinges for My Cooler?

Finding original manufacturer (OEM) hinges is always the best bet for coolers. If they’re unavailable, your next best option is to carefully measure all dimensions: length, width, pin size, and especially the screw hole spacing and pattern. Look for replacement hinges made from durable, UV-resistant plastic or coated metal, suitable for outdoor use. Be wary of ‘universal’ kits, as they often don’t fit perfectly and can lead to premature failure.

Are Cabinet Hinges Interchangeable with Other Furniture Hinges?

Cabinet hinges are designed for specific applications, and while some might appear similar, interchangeability is not guaranteed. Factors like the overlay type (how the door sits on the cabinet frame), the opening angle, the screw placement, and the load capacity are all important. For most furniture, it’s best to source hinges from the manufacturer or find exact replacements based on detailed measurements and specifications.

How Do I Measure a Hinge for Replacement?

Start by carefully removing the old hinge if possible. Lay it flat and measure its total length and width. Then, measure the dimensions of each ‘leaf’ (the flat part that attaches to the surface). Measure the diameter and length of the hinge pin. Importantly, measure the spacing between the centers of the screw holes in both directions and the diameter of the holes themselves. Note the material and any special features like soft-close mechanisms or specific opening angles.
